STATE OF EMERGENCY DECLARED FOR BRIDEGWATER TOWNSHIP 
The Bridgewater Office of Emergency Management has declared a State of Emergency for all of Bridgewater Township starting at 3pm, Sunday February 22. All non-essential travel is banned, including travel on all municipal, county and state-owned roadways in Bridgewater (see attached documents). See the Snow Emergency Routes:

Please assist our DPW by removing all vehicles from the streets.
